India's exports surged 19.4% in November, defying US tariffs, with shipments to China and the US showing significant growth. Engineering and electronics goods led the rise. The trade deficit narrowed to a five-month low as imports of gold and crude oil declined. This resilience highlights market diversification and sector strength.
